- W1750481441 abstract "Introduction: In Hungary and all around the world the incidence of consumption of energy drinks together with alcohol has increased among adolescents and young adults. Aim: The foremost aim of this survey was to find out whether alcohol mixed with energy drinks can enhance the appearance of other forms of risky behaviour among young adults. Method: In spring 2013 the authors carried out a quantitative sociological survey at three faculties of two major universities in Budapest, Hungary. Results: The survey showed that 1) consumers, who mixed alcohol with energy drinks, were likely to drink more alcohol both at parties and on ordinary days, and they took part in binge drinking more frequently than those consuming only alcohol; 2) students drank significantly less alcohol when they mixed it with energy drink. Conclusions: The conflicts of the results showed that even at the starting point there was a clear distinction between the two groups, moreover, it is not yet clear what interactions the combined effect of caffeine and alcohol can trigger in the behaviour of the individual.
